Abstract: Copper is one of the best light metal based on their properties and usefulness in the field of precision parts.Emergence of advanced engineering materials, unusual size and intricate shape of jobleads towards the use of non-conventional machining processes. Laser beam machining (LBM) is one of them which is non-contact and optical-thermal process used for machining almost all range of engineering materials. Artificial neural network is used to develop a prediction model representing complex relationship between the input (process) parameters and output parameters (responses). In this present paper, micro-drilling has been performed on 0.2 mm thickcopper sheet by Nd:YVO4 laser of 12 kW. Design of experiment is performed by Taguchi's L9 orthogonal array. Here, hole taper and HAZ width have been observed varying the process parameters like laser beam power, pulse frequency, scanning speed and number of pass. Experimental results are analyzed by S/N ratio and verified by confirmation experiment. A feed forward back propagation ANN model is also developed to predict the responses at any combination of process parameters within the limit.

Abstract: The determination of the temperature distribution of submerged arc-welded plates is essential when designing submerged arc-welded joints. The key role for the change of weld-bead geometry dimension, thermal stress, residual stress, tensile stress, hardness, etc., is heat input. Heat input is the function of temperature distribution of submerged arc welded plates. An attempt is made in this paper to find the analytical solution for a moving heat-source of egg-shape in a semi-infinite body. The considered modes of heat transfer for this study are conduction and convection. The solution has been obtained by integrating the instantaneous point heat source throughout the heat source volume. Very good agreement between the predicted and measured transient temperatures at various points on submerged arc-welded plates has been obtained. The predicted yield parameters are also in good agreement with the measured values.
